Leeds agree to sell 28-year-old star for £10m

Leeds are hoping to strengthen their squad sufficient to have a workforce able to avoiding relegation from the Premier League, however so as to have the utmost funds accessible to make signings, gross sales is also wanted.

One space that Leeds wish to handle this summer time is their extensive choices. The hope is for Manor Solomon to re-sign from Tottenham, whereas they’ve additionally been linked with a transfer for Slavia Prague’s El Hadji Malick Diouf.

However there is also outgoings on this space, and the favorite on this regard is Jack Harrison, who returned to Leeds earlier in the summertime following the tip of his Everton mortgage spell.

Leeds anticipated to hearken to provides for Jack Harrison

Jack Harrison was on mortgage at Everton final season (Photograph by Imago)

As per Soccer Insider (by way of The Leeds Press), former Leeds goalkeeper Paul Robison doesn’t anticipate Harrison to nonetheless be at Elland Street by the tip of the summer time.

“I’m undecided he’s obtained a future at Leeds with the supervisor there. I believe the best way that the supervisor has been fairly open to letting him go, whether or not it was financially or regardless of the motive was within the Championship.

“Have a look at a few of the different characters that Daniel Farke has moved out of the dressing room, and the gamers that he likes to work with. Jack Harrison, at 28, remains to be contracted at Leeds till 2028 which is stunning. Whoever’s going to come back in for him, it will possible be a mortgage, probably a charge concerned.

“Leeds paid £10m to signal him from Man Metropolis in 2021. I don’t assume they’ll get that, however any person could take an opportunity for round that mark.”

A return to Everton may very well be potential for Harrison, on condition that he was frequently counted upon final season. He made 38 appearances in all competitions, and so they will not be the final ones he makes in a blue jersey.
